How Wall Cavity Water Extraction Actually Works

The process of wall cavity water extraction is more complex than you might think. When water seeps into a wall cavity, it can cause structural damage, mold growth, and even electrical hazards. Our team takes a meticulous approach to ensure every step is done correctly, from locating the source of the leak to extracting the water and drying the area.

Step 1: Inspection and Assessment

Our technicians use specialized equipment to detect where the water is coming from and the extent of the damage. This is crucial in determining the best course of action and preventing further damage. We’ll identify any potential safety hazards and develop a plan to address them.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We use industrial-grade pumps and vacuums to extract the water from the wall cavity. This is a delicate process that needs care to avoid causing further damage to the surrounding structure. Our goal is to remove as much water as possible to prevent secondary damage.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water is extracted, we use specialized equipment to dry the wall cavity and surrounding areas. This is a critical step in preventing mold growth and ensuring the structure is stable. We’ll also use d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

After the drying process is complete, we’ll clean and sanitize the area to prevent any potential health hazards. This includes disinfecting any surfaces and removing any debris or contaminants.

Step 5: Inspection and Testing

Finally, we’ll inspect the area to ensure it’s safe and dry. We’ll also perform any necessary testing to verify the structure is stable and there are no signs of further damage.

Warning Signs You Need Wall Cavity Water Extraction

Catch these warning signs early to prevent costly damage and prevent further problems. Ignoring these signs can lead to bigger issues down the line.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Musty odors can be a sign of water damage or mold growth. If you notice persistent musty smells, it’s time to investigate further.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ution.

Water Stains on Walls or Ceiling

Water stains on walls or ceiling can show water damage or a leak.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age and costly repairs.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. Our team can help you identify the cause and provide a solution to prevent further damage.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age or a leak.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age and costly repairs.

Mold Growth or Mildew

Mold growth or mildew can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. Our team can help you identify the cause and provide a solution to prevent further damage and health hazards.

Unexplained Leaks or Water Damage

Unexplained leaks or water damage can be a sign of a larger issue.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ution to prevent further damage.

Wall Cavity Water Extraction Cost in Lake Stevens, WA

The cost of wall cavity water extraction var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lake Stevens, WA.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500, with the average cost being around $1,500. But, these prices may vary depending on the specifics of your situ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Inspection and Assessment $100-$500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Water Extraction $500-$2,500 Size of affected area, amount of water
Drying and Dehumidification $200-$1,000 Size of affected area, humidity levels
Cleaning and Sanitizing $100-$500 Size of affected area, extent of damage
Inspection and Testing $100-$500 Size of affected area, extent of damage
